How are Mandarin orange and Daikon different?

  • Mandarin orange is richer in Vitamin C, while Daikon is higher in Copper.
  • Mandarin orange contains 4 times more Sugar than Daikon. Mandarin orange contains 10.58g of Sugar, while Daikon contains 2.5g.

Tangerines, (mandarin oranges), raw and Radishes, oriental, raw types were used in this article.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Mandarin orange Daikon Opinion
Net carbs 11.54g 2.5g Mandarin orange
Protein 0.81g 0.6g Mandarin orange
Fats 0.31g 0.1g Mandarin orange
Carbs 13.34g 4.1g Mandarin orange
Calories 53kcal 18kcal Mandarin orange
Fructose 2.4g Mandarin orange
Sugar 10.58g 2.5g Daikon
Fiber 1.8g 1.6g Mandarin orange
Calcium 37mg 27mg Mandarin orange
Iron 0.15mg 0.4mg Daikon
Magnesium 12mg 16mg Daikon
Phosphorus 20mg 23mg Daikon
Potassium 166mg 227mg Daikon
Sodium 2mg 21mg Mandarin orange
Zinc 0.07mg 0.15mg Daikon
Copper 0.042mg 0.115mg Daikon
Manganese 0.039mg 0.038mg Mandarin orange
Selenium 0.1µg 0.7µg Daikon
Vitamin A 681IU 0IU Mandarin orange
Vitamin A RAE 34µg 0µg Mandarin orange
Vitamin E 0.2mg 0mg Mandarin orange
Vitamin C 26.7mg 22mg Mandarin orange
Vitamin B1 0.058mg 0.02mg Mandarin orange
Vitamin B2 0.036mg 0.02mg Mandarin orange
Vitamin B3 0.376mg 0.2mg Mandarin orange
Vitamin B5 0.216mg 0.138mg Mandarin orange
Vitamin B6 0.078mg 0.046mg Mandarin orange
Folate 16µg 28µg Daikon
Vitamin K 0µg 0.3µg Daikon
Tryptophan 0.002mg 0.003mg Daikon
Threonine 0.016mg 0.025mg Daikon
Isoleucine 0.017mg 0.026mg Daikon
Leucine 0.028mg 0.031mg Daikon
Lysine 0.032mg 0.03mg Mandarin orange
Methionine 0.002mg 0.006mg Daikon
Phenylalanine 0.018mg 0.02mg Daikon
Valine 0.021mg 0.028mg Daikon
Histidine 0.011mg 0.011mg
Saturated Fat 0.039g 0.03g Daikon
Monounsaturated Fat 0.06g 0.017g Mandarin orange
Polyunsaturated fat 0.065g 0.045g Mandarin orange
